How do you filter ads and trackers outside of a browser while still using a VPN service?
  • On a rooted phone, you could edit your /etc/hosts file with a list of blocked domains. Outside of that, I'm not aware of any way to have a filtering app and a VPN app at the same time.

    Alternatively, you could try hosting a DNS server that doesn't resolve the domains you want blocked, like a pihole server. Some VPN apps allow you to use your own DNS and if you're feeling up for it, there's apparently even a way to run a local DNS server using dnsmasq on your phone mentioned in this link.

    Sanity check: Yubikeys and password shares
  • If you're just storing the password on the key then, no you can't get it unless you have the key. The main usage (arguably) for a yubikey is the FIDO2 auth method where you add those keys as MFA methods. That would allow access using either key.

    Proxmox on Laptop, Network Setup
  • You definitely should try something with an actual desktop. It sounds like you're wanting a headed server with virtualization capabilities. I'd personally run LXD or KVM and LXC if I needed a type 2 hypervisor and containers like what you're saying. Luckily, a ton of distros support both of these at this point.

    Btw, proxmox utilizes KVM and LXC on the backend. So the only difference is that you're leveraging the tools directly. If you're a CS student then learning the underlying tools is the best way to learn about a system and how it all interacts.
